File amarok-gcc44.patch of Package kde3-amarok
--- amarok/src/metadata/wav/wavproperties.cpp.orig 2009-11-15 01:49:13.000000000 +0100
+++ amarok/src/metadata/wav/wavproperties.cpp 2009-11-15 10:01:50.000000000 +0100
@@ -31,6 +31,8 @@
#include <netinet/in.h> // ntohl
+#include <cstdio>
+
using namespace TagLib;
struct WavHeader
--- amarok/src/metadata/wav/wavfiletyperesolver.cpp.orig 2008-08-13 23:21:51.000000000 +0200
+++ amarok/src/metadata/wav/wavfiletyperesolver.cpp 2009-11-15 10:01:50.000000000 +0100
@@ -22,7 +22,8 @@
#include "wavfiletyperesolver.h"
#include "wavfile.h"
-#include <string.h>
+#include <cstring>
+#include <cstdio>
TagLib::File *WavFileTypeResolver::createFile(const char *fileName,
bool readProperties,
--- amarok/src/metadata/wav/wavfile.cpp.orig 2008-08-13 23:21:51.000000000 +0200
+++ amarok/src/metadata/wav/wavfile.cpp 2009-11-15 10:01:50.000000000 +0100
@@ -25,6 +25,8 @@
#include "wavfile.h"
+#include <cstdio>
+
#include <taglib/tfile.h>
#include <taglib/audioproperties.h>
#include <taglib/tag.h>
--- amarok/src/metadata/audible/audibletag.cpp.orig 2008-08-13 23:21:51.000000000 +0200
+++ amarok/src/metadata/audible/audibletag.cpp 2009-11-15 10:01:50.000000000 +0100
@@ -28,8 +28,9 @@
#include <taglib/tag.h>
#include <netinet/in.h> // ntohl
-#include <stdlib.h>
-#include <string.h>
+#include <cstdlib>
+#include <cstring>
+#include <cstdio>
using namespace TagLib;
--- amarok/src/metadata/audible/taglib_audiblefile.cpp.orig 2008-08-13 23:21:51.000000000 +0200
+++ amarok/src/metadata/audible/taglib_audiblefile.cpp 2009-11-15 10:01:50.000000000 +0100
@@ -25,6 +25,8 @@
#include "taglib_audiblefile.h"
+#include <cstdio>
+
#include "audibletag.h"
#include <taglib/tfile.h>
#include <taglib/audioproperties.h>
--- amarok/src/metadata/audible/taglib_audiblefiletyperesolver.cpp.orig 2008-08-13 23:21:51.000000000 +0200
+++ amarok/src/metadata/audible/taglib_audiblefiletyperesolver.cpp 2009-11-15 10:01:50.000000000 +0100
@@ -22,7 +22,8 @@
#include "taglib_audiblefiletyperesolver.h"
#include "taglib_audiblefile.h"
-#include <string.h>
+#include <cstring>
+#include <cstdio>
TagLib::File *AudibleFileTypeResolver::createFile(const char *fileName,
bool readProperties,
--- amarok/src/metadata/audible/audibleproperties.cpp.orig 2008-08-13 23:21:51.000000000 +0200
+++ amarok/src/metadata/audible/audibleproperties.cpp 2009-11-15 10:01:50.000000000 +0100
@@ -25,6 +25,8 @@
#include "audibleproperties.h"
+#include <cstdio>
+
#include <taglib/tstring.h>
#include "taglib_audiblefile.h"
--- amarok/src/metabundlesaver.cpp.orig 2009-11-15 10:02:01.000000000 +0100
+++ amarok/src/metabundlesaver.cpp 2009-11-15 10:02:16.000000000 +0100
@@ -4,10 +4,10 @@
#define DEBUG_PREFIX "MetaBundleSaver"
-#include <stdlib.h>
+#include <cstdlib>
#include <unistd.h>
-#include <stdio.h>
-#include <time.h>
+#include <cstdio>
+#include <ctime>
#include <sys/time.h>
#include <sys/types.h>
#include <fcntl.h>